Is it safe to use an i-opener on a battery that has inflated?
Subject line kind of says it all. I have a late-2013 MBP whose battery has inflated, i.e. filled up with gas. Obviously it needs to be replaced but I’m wondering if an i-opener can still be used to free up the adhesive in a situation like this. I’m concerned that the heat will cause the gas to expand and possibly create a hazardous situation. I’m also wondering if the trapped gas will act as an insulator and prevent the i-opener from working at all. Has anyone tried this?
